| Career Roles | Key Responsibilities |
|---|---|
| Mental Health Counselor | Provide therapy and support to individuals experiencing mental health issues. |
| Mental Health Case Manager | Coordinate services and resources for clients with mental health needs. |
| Mental Health Advocate | Raise awareness and promote policies that support mental health wellness. |
| Mental Health Educator | Provide education and training on mental health topics to individuals and groups. |
| Mental Health Researcher | Conduct research studies to advance understanding of mental health issues. |
